on apt-get upgrade or apt-get install, splunk does NOT stop/start it's service.
that's fine, but if an operator misses starting it again before reboot - the whole machine will hang on boot.. waiting for you input.. with or without ssh starting up first. which leaves you with a remote machine hung and inaccessible.
─rc───S20splunk───splunk───python───more
if splunk has installed it's init.d to startup on boot, can we have a switch to accept the EULA? or perhaps the EULA should persist between versions (as much as possible).
Yes there is, and it's documented here
Your startup command becomes ./splunk start --accept-license
